Page 12: GHY University: Global Free Trade Agreements-  CaseSstudies of Utilization; the Risks, Benefits and Opportunities

• Side by Side Comparison of Free Trade Agreements and Selected Preferential Trade Legislation Programs - Non Textiles: http://www.cbp.gov/sites/default/files/documents/Side-by-Side-7_7_15.pdf

• Know your responsibility before making a Trade Agreement Claim with respect to Reasonable Care, Recordkeeping and Customs Value

• Textile sector is one of the largest manufacturing employers in the United States

• 40% of the duties collected by CBP in fiscal year 2014 were related to textile imports

• Average duty rate of 16% and more than $21.1 billion of entered textiles and wearing apparel claim preferential tariff treatment

• High Risk for non compliance and therefore a CBP Trade Priority

FREE TRADE AGREEMENTS
